The Art of Hand-Painted Theatre Backdrops

For centuries , the creation of theatre backdrops has remained a unique form of artistic expression. These impressive painted canvases, once crucial to bringing stories to life, are slowly recognized as works of art in their own right. Experienced scene designers employ time-honored techniques, blending dyes and tools to conjure evocative landscapes, imaginary realms, and detailed interiors. The process is a lengthy one, requiring significant planning and a comprehensive understanding of perspective, lighting, and dramatic illusion.

Green Screen Muslin Screens: Perfecting Green Screen Looks

Creating realistic scenes with green screen muslin backdrops is fairly straightforward when you understand the key principles. This type of fabric screens offer a clean surface for perfect keying, allowing you to place your subjects into fantastic virtual environments. Correct lighting is completely important – directing your illumination to prevent shadows and make certain an consistent illumination over the emerald fabric is crucial for a polished final product. Remember to choose a good muslin backdrop and experiment with various settings in your video editing tool to create truly impressive chromakey effects.
